Official portrait of american revolutionary war general arthur st. Clair (1737-1818). Object Type: painting. Genre: portrait. Date: between 1782 and 1784. Dimensions: height: 221.2 in (561.9 cm) ; width: 191.1 in (485.4 cm). Medium: oil on canvas. Depicted People: Arthur St. Clair. Collection: Independence National Historical Park.
